.slide{display:block;float:left;height:auto;margin:0 0;padding:0;position:relative;visibility:hidden;width:100%;}
.carousel-inner{overflow:hidden;position:relative;width:100%;}
.carousel-inner > .item{backface-visibility:hidden;perspective:1000px;transition:transform 0.6s ease-in-out 0s;}
.carousel-inner > .item{display:none;position:relative;transition:left 0.6s ease-in-out 0s;}
.carousel-inner > .item{backface-visibility:hidden;perspective:1000px;transition:transform 0.6s ease-in-out 0s;}
.carousel-inner > .item.active.right, .carousel-inner > .item.next{left:0;transform:translate3d(100%, 0px, 0px);}
.carousel-inner > .item.active.left, .carousel-inner > .item.prev{left:0;transform:translate3d(-100%, 0px, 0px);}
.carousel-inner > .item.active, .carousel-inner > .item.next.left, .carousel-inner > .item.prev.right{left:0;transform:translate3d(0px, 0px, 0px);}
.carousel-inner > .active, .carousel-inner > .next, .carousel-inner > .prev{display:block;}
.carousel-inner > .active{left:0;}
.carousel-inner > .next, .carousel-inner > .prev{position:absolute;top:0;width:100%;}
.carousel-inner > .next{left:100%;}
.carousel-inner > .prev{left:-100%;}
.carousel-inner > .next.left, .carousel-inner > .prev.right{left:0;}
.carousel-inner > .active.left{left:-100%;}
.carousel-inner > .active.right{left:100%;}
.carousel-control{background-color:rgba(0, 0, 0, 0);bottom:0;color:#ffffff;font-size:20px;left:0;opacity:0.5;position:absolute;text-align:center;text-shadow:0 1px 2px rgba(0, 0, 0, 0.6);top:0;width:15%;}
.carousel-control.left{background-image:linear-gradient(to right, rgba(0, 0, 0, 0.5) 0px, rgba(0, 0, 0, 0) 100%);background-repeat:repeat-x;}
.carousel-control.right{background-image:linear-gradient(to right, rgba(0, 0, 0, 0) 0px, rgba(0, 0, 0, 0.5) 100%);background-repeat:repeat-x;left:auto;right:0;}
.carousel-control:focus, .carousel-control:hover{color:#ffffff;opacity:0.9;outline:0 none;text-decoration:none;}
.carousel-control .glyphicon-chevron-left, .carousel-control .glyphicon-chevron-right, .carousel-control .icon-next, .carousel-control .icon-prev{display:inline-block;margin-top:-10px;position:absolute;top:50%;z-index:5;}
.carousel-control .glyphicon-chevron-left, .carousel-control .icon-prev{left:50%;margin-left:-10px;}
.carousel-control .glyphicon-chevron-right, .carousel-control .icon-next{margin-right:-10px;right:50%;}
.carousel-control .icon-next, .carousel-control .icon-prev{font-family:serif;height:20px;line-height:1;width:20px;}
.carousel-control .icon-prev::before{content:"‹";}
.carousel-control .icon-next::before{content:"›";}
.carousel-indicators{bottom:10px;left:50%;list-style:outside none none;margin-left:-30%;padding-left:0;position:absolute;text-align:center;width:60%;z-index:15;}
.carousel-indicators li{background-color:rgba(0, 0, 0, 0);border:1px solid #ffffff;border-radius:10px;cursor:pointer;display:inline-block;height:10px;margin:1px;text-indent:-999px;width:10px;}
.carousel-indicators .active{background-color:#ffffff;height:12px;margin:0;width:12px;}
.carousel-caption{bottom:20px;color:#ffffff;left:15%;padding-bottom:20px;padding-top:20px;position:absolute;right:15%;text-align:center;text-shadow:0 1px 2px rgba(0, 0, 0, 0.6);z-index:10;}
.carousel-caption .btn{text-shadow:none;}
@media screen and (min-width:768px){.carousel-control .glyphicon-chevron-left, .carousel-control .glyphicon-chevron-right, .carousel-control .icon-next, .carousel-control .icon-prev{font-size:30px;height:30px;margin-top:-10px;width:30px;}
.carousel-control .glyphicon-chevron-left, .carousel-control .icon-prev{margin-left:-10px;}
.carousel-control .glyphicon-chevron-right, .carousel-control .icon-next{margin-right:-10px;}
.carousel-caption{left:20%;padding-bottom:30px;right:20%;}
.carousel-indicators{bottom:0px;}
}
.carousel-inner > .item{text-align:center;}
.carousel-inner > .item,
.carousel-inner > .item > a,
.carousel-inner > .item > img,
/*.carousel-inner > .item > a > img{margin:auto;padding:0;max-width:100%;max-height:290px;background:rgba(114, 114, 114, 0.21);} PARA LIMITAR EL ALTO*/
.carousel-inner > .item > a > img{margin:auto;padding:0;width:100%;heigth:auto;float:left;}
div.active,
div.left,
div.next,
div.prev,
div.right{visibility:visible;}
#myCarousel{height:auto;margin:0;padding:0;overflow:hidden;}
#myCarousel .carousel-control,
#myCarousel .carousel-indicators,
#myCarousel .carousel-indicators .active,
#myCarousel div.descripcion_slide{visibility:hidden !important;transition:0.3s ease 0s;}
#myCarousel:hover .carousel-control,
#myCarousel:hover .carousel-indicators,
#myCarousel:hover .carousel-indicators .active/*,
#myCarousel:hover div.descripcion_slide*/{visibility:visible !important;}
#myCarousel .descripcion_slide{ 
background: rgba(255,255,255,0.8) none repeat scroll 0 0;
    float: left;
    font-size: 1.1em;
    font-weight: bold;
    left: 0;
    padding: 5px 0;
    position: absolute;
    text-align: center;
    top: 0;
    width: 100%;
    color: #666;
}
#myCarousel .carousel-control{width:10%;}
#myCarousel .carousel-indicators li{background:#bbb; margin:0 5px;}
#myCarousel .carousel-indicators .active{background:#333;}
.fecha_izq{float:left;position:relative;width:100%;height:100%;background:url(../img/1left.png) no-repeat center center;}
.fecha_drc{float:left;position:relative;width:100%;height:100%;background:url(../img/1right.png) no-repeat center center;}
@media (max-width:750px){.carousel-inner > .item,
.carousel-inner > .item > a,
.carousel-inner > .item > img,
.carousel-inner > .item > a > img{max-height:none;}
#myCarousel{height:auto;}
}